内容説明・目次

内容説明

The primary aim of this monograph is to provide a systematic state-of-the-art summary of the light-scattering bioparticles. Considering the widespread need for this information in optics, remote sensing, engineering, medicine and biology, this volume should be of value and interest to graduate students, scientists and engineers working on various aspects of electromagnetic scattering and its applications.

目次

Introduction Chapter 1. Direct light-scattering problem of individual particles Mie theory T-matrix approach Discrete dipole approximation Wentzel-Kramer-Brillouin approximation Chapter 2. Flow cytrometry in measurement of light scattering of individual particles Flow cytometry in measurement of light scattering of individual particles Scanning flow cytometer Polarizing scanning flow cytometer Chapter 3. Inverse light-scattering problem of individual particles Homogeneous spherical particles Spherical particles with absorption Spherical particles with a cover Spheroidal particles Neural network Chapter 4. Applications Polymer particles Polymer beads analyzed with polarizing scanning flow cytometer Polymerization Milk fat particles Red blood cells Bacterial cells Lymphocytes Bispheres Conclusion Acknowledgements Bibliography
